
Krept & Konan announce first studio album in five years, Young Kingz 2
Rap duo Krept & Konan have announced their return with the upcoming fourth studio album, Young Kingz 2.
“Young Kingz was an independent project that transformed our lives and marked a staple moment in our journey. Now, we've come full circle, once again creating as independent artists with Young Kingz 2,” the duo says.
Young Kingz 2 marks Krept & Konan’s first album since Revenge Is Sweet, a project which saw them become the first British rap act to headline the O2 London. It also follows the duo’s 2017 release of 7 DAYS and 7 NIGHTS, which saw them become the first act ever to have two mixtapes simultaneously enter the top ten of the Official UK Albums chart, and their 2015 debut album The Long Way Home which became the highest charting British Rap album in UK chart history.
Young Kingz 2 is set for release via their independent label, Play Dirty on 7 February 2025.
